Rolleiflex 2.8 E @ 1956
Rolleiflex 2,8 E
Model K7E
The first model with built-in metering
October 1956 - September 1959,
44,000 pieces
Serials: 1.621.000 - 1.665.999, engraved above name plate.
Taking Lens:
Planar 2,8/80mm, Carl Zeiss Oberkochen,
and Xenotar 2,8/80mm, Schneider,
both Bayonet 3
Finder lens:
Zeiss or Schneider Heidosmat 2,8/80mm, Bayonet 3. Interchangeable finder loupe. Parallax control.
Shutter:
Synchro Compur MXV, 1 - 1/500 sec., B, X-sync., self timer.
Film: 120 for 12 exp. 6x6, and 35mm adapter Rolleikin 2.
Film Transportation: winding lever with auto stop on first exposure, exposure counter for exposures 1-12. Blank film pressure plate.
Dimensions: 11.1x10.5x14.6cm.
Weight: 1,255 grams.
